I got a TEKK short antenna. It worked great until I went through a car wash and it snapped off. I couldn't get the post out of the antenna base and needed to replace it. I ordered one through Phil Long Ford for $44. It would have been really easy if i could have removed the base at the hood (3 bolts) and didn't have to run the whole wire but the wire would not come out of the base for me...grrrrr. The replacement comes with the wire but it goes through the firewall and under the dash which makes this a real pain to replace. It's going through the firewall that is the pain. If i could just pull the new cable with the old one, life would be good. Kameron S made a great video on doing this the easy way but mine would not come out without damage so now i must run the whole cable. Ran out of daylight the other day before I could get it done.
